Interested in becoming a Campaign Intern?

United Way of Regina’s Community Campaign Internship Program is a powerful professional development program. It combines skill development and leadership training with community involvement.

This program greatly enhances the abilities and talents of any employee who participates.  Our participants return to their workplaces with new skills and a real desire to succeed.

Our team of interns are invaluable to United Way in helping achieve our Circle of Care Campaign goal. This is an unique opportunity to enhance the qualities of an employee and make a meaningful contribution to your community.

United Way of Regina now on Twitter

United Way of Regina is now on Twitter at www.twitter.com/unitedwayregina.

Twitter is a social networking and micro-blogging service that allows its users to send and read other users' updates (otherwise known as tweets), which are text-based posts of up to 140 characters in length. You do not need to set up your own account to follow our updates on Twitter.
